Mpirun environment variables. The -tune command line option and its synonym -mca mca_base_envar_file_prefix allows a user to set mca parameters and environment variables with the syntax described below. hydra/mpirun command. Open MPI provides the following environment variables that will be defined on every MPI process: OMPI_COMM_WORLD_LOCAL_SIZE: the number of ranks from this job that are running on this node. Warnings are printed in case of removed or misprinted environment variables. For example: % mpirun -x DISPLAY -x OFILE=/tmp/out Use the -xargs option (where args is the environment variable (s) you want to use) to specify any environment variable you want to pass during runtime. -genv <name> <value> The. Aug 20, 2021 · I assumed it had to do with the environmental variables, that Linux just can't find the software. Do not use the -genv or -env options for setting the <size> value. In this case, you do not need to create a host file. Set the I_MPI_OUTPUT_CHUNK_SIZE environment variable in the shell environment before executing the mpiexec. This option requires a single file or list of files separated by "," to follow. Existing environment variables can be specified or new variable names specified with corresponding values. Environmental parameters can also be set/forwarded to the new processes using the MCA parameter mca_base_env_list. 6 days ago · Environment variables set for MPI applications. Those options are used only for passing environment variables to the MPI process environment. May 27, 2015 · Export the specified environment variables to the remote nodes before executing the program. Only one environment variable can be specified per -x option. May 20, 2019 · Note that the -mca switch is simply a shortcut for setting environment variables. The mpirun command uses MCA (Multiple Component Architecture) parameters to pass environment variables. By default, all -envlist <list> Pass the listed environment variables names separated by commas, with their current values, to the processes being run by mpiexec. OMPI_COMM_WORLD_LOCAL_RANK: the relative rank of this process on this node within its job. This Developer Reference provides you with the complete reference for the Intel(R) MPI Library. Nov 16, 2021 · Setting MCA parameters and environment variables from file. 6 days ago · All environment variables that are named in the form OMPI_* will automatically be exported to new processes on the local and remote nodes. Mar 20, 2020 · Note that the -mca switch is simply a shortcut for setting environment variables. So I went looking and found that in the OpenMPI FAQ, it mentions the following: Use this environment variable to print out a warning if an unsupported environment variable is set. The same effect may be accomplished by setting corresponding environment variables before running mpirun. iables other than ones specied with other -env or -genv arguments to the processes being run by mpiexec. The -x option exports the variable specified in args and sets the value for args from the current environment. The form of the environment variables that Open MPI sets is: OMPI_MCA_<key>=<value> Thus, the -mca switch overrides any previously set environment variables. To specify an MCA parameter, use the -mca option with the mpirun command, and then specify the parameter type, the parameter you want to pass as an environment variable, and the value you want to set. The mpirun command extracts the host list from the respective environment and uses these nodes automatically according to the above scheme. tkfv phvix jjrhl sedf gfiw rcby pml kxws yzh ceco
26th Apr 2024